If you are logical, organised, analytical and numerate, a career in accounting could be for you. Accountants work in all areas of business and in the public and voluntary sectors using their financial expertise to inform management decision-making and advise an organisation how to maximise profitability and efficiency. Some careers may require further study, training and/or work experience beyond your degree such as becoming a Chartered Accountant or a Chartered Financial Analyst.
